I Prevail and singer Brian Burkheiser mutually part ways

I Prevail and singer Brian Burkheiser have parted ways mutually, according to a statement the band released to social media on May 15, 2025. The group's other vocalist, Eric Vanlerberghe, will continue in the frontman role, while guitarist Dylan Bowman will take on more vocal duties for the band's live shows. "Today we share that... Summer of Loud Tour to feature metalcore heavyweights Beartooth, I Prevail, Killswitch Engage, Parkway Drive, more

The 2025 Summer of Loud Tour, produced by Sound Talent Group and Live Nation, will feature four rotating headliners: Beartooth, I Prevail, Killswitch Engage and Parkway Drive.
